feminine · Portuguese (Brazilian) origin
Terezinha is a Brazilian Portuguese diminutive of Teresa, which itself derives from the ancient Greek name Therasia, possibly connected to the Greek island of Thera or to the Greek word meaning to harvest or to reap. The diminutive suffix lends the name an affectionate, familiar quality that has made it especially popular in Brazil as an independent given name in its own right. It shares its heritage with the broader family of forms including Teresa, Theresa, Theresia, and Teresinha.
